Recently many users have received their Netflix Instant Streaming Disc that began shipping a few days ago.

As mentioned previously, the disc is required to use the Netflix steaming service on the PlayStation 3 until 2010, when a Firmware update will take its place.

Today Microsoft's Major Nelson has announced that they will be offering an additional $50 rebate on the XBox 360 Elite until October 5, 2009.

This comes just weeks after the price drop of the XBox 360 Elite from $399 to $299, meaning after rebate it's just $249- not bad at all!
